Merck & Company Executives Make Bold Moves with Stock Transactions

New insider activity at Merck & Company ( (MRK) ) has taken place on February 8, 2025.

In recent stock transactions involving Merck & Company, Chief Communications & Public Affairs Officer Cristal N. Downing sold 2,361 shares valued at $209,538. Meanwhile, Executive Chairman Inge Thulin made a purchase of 2,832 shares worth $249,924. Additionally, Executive Chairman of the Board Douglas M. Baker acquired 15,000 shares with a total investment of $1,327,500.

Recent Updates on MRK stock

Merck & Company’s stock has experienced notable price target reductions recently due to several challenges. Analysts cited the company’s below-consensus outlook and shifting expectations for its consistent product line as major concerns. Additionally, Merck’s decision to halt Gardasil vaccine shipments to China until inventories stabilize has brought renewed focus on challenges related to its Keytruda product. Despite strong financial performance in 2024, the market’s confidence appears shaken, prompting analysts to adjust their expectations. The company is seen as undervalued with potential for recovery, contingent on consistent achievement of guidance and positive developments such as approvals and data releases.
